Overview introductionDo you see dinosaurs? Most children love dinosaurs and can tell you their complex names and characteristics. Dinosaurs provide a great opportunity to talk about creatures that are now extinct and to compare life when they ruled the earth, to life in the 21st century. You could show the image (see page 7) or share it with children on a whiteboard, but it could be more engaging if you printed and mounted it on thin card to act as a backdrop to a ‘Tuff’ tray filled with grass, leaves, twigs and model dinosaurs. Talk with children about the different dinosaur species, where they lived and what they ate. Discuss carnivores, herbivores and omnivores and how we know so much about these creatures, even though they lived so long ago.
